In a recent social media response, GTA V's actor for Michael De Santa, Ned Luke, disclosed that the notorious yoga mission from the game wasn't only unpopular with gamers, it was additionally a nightmare to shoot too. According to Luke, the motion capture session for the mission lasted a grueling eight hours and left him physically exhausted, calling it “hands down the worst to shoot.”

Ned Luke's blunt opinion on GTA V's yoga mission

The moment came when GTA 6 Countdown posted about the yoga mission being the worst part of GTA V, prompting Ned Luke to bluntly respond with his own behind-the-scenes experience, "Sweated my ass off for 8 hours. Hands down the worst to shoot."

The response quickly went viral among the gaming community, as many of them have for a long time made light of the slow pace and cringe-worthy gameplay of the mission.The "Did Somebody Say Yoga?" mission was intended to be a humorous but contemplative section of the game, with Michael trying to reconnect with his wife.

But its rhythm-shattering quick-time yoga actions provoked mixed responses. Now that Luke has given us a behind-the-scenes look, it's apparent that the scene didn't come easy to the actor either, particularly considering the physicality of motion capture.
